Devil In Dune
In a future Earth turned to desert by human impact, survivors seek refuge in the 'Oasis' from mutated 'sand worms'. A diverse team embarks on a perilous journey in an armored vehicle, pursued by these lethal creatures.
In a future Earth turned to desert by human impact, survivors seek refuge in the 'Oasis' from mutated 'sand worms'. A diverse team embarks on a perilous journey in an armored vehicle, pursued by these lethal creatures.